## Build Provenance: Bramblewick Bounce Processor

If you're on call and the bounce processor starts misclassifying soft bounces, first check which build is actually deployed — the Bramblewick pipeline sometimes promotes stale artifacts after a rollback. Provenance records live in the deploy manifest, and every artifact carries a signed stamp. Match the running instance against the token shown below.

pipeline stamp: htk4_ae36

Alert: LedgerDrift detected on the Tansel loyalty-points ledger. The nightly reconciliation job found accrual totals diverging from redemption balances beyond the 0.5% threshold. This usually means a stuck consumer on the points-events queue. Check consumer lag first; do not replay events manually. Triage steps and the reconciliation dashboard are linked from the internal page here.

operations page: https://jira.qorvelsys.internal/browse/pages/browse/pages

Ticket: Missed pick-up – spare parts for Varnholt relay site

Hey dispatch, the courier never showed for yesterday's run, so the gearbox seals for Varnholt are still sitting on the bench. Can you rebook with Quickstead for tomorrow morning? Site crew is getting antsy. When the driver arrives, follow this hand-over step:

handover note for yagef-bagep: the drudor pelius courier leaves the kasdor zorvan norir ledger at gate 8016 under passcode 755406